30 Norfolk Place, London, United Kingdom (Open map)
Kersley Mews 1, London, United Kingdom (Open map)
51 Tabernacle Street 3, London, United Kingdom (Open map)
Wellington Court, Penthouse D, 55 Wellin, Gton Road, London, United Kingdom (Open map)
9 Old Queen St, London, United Kingdom (Open map)
46 Great Sutton Street, London, United Kingdom (Open map)
Torrington Place, London, United Kingdom (Open map)
Sw1V 4Df 57 St. Georges Drive, London, United Kingdom (Open map)
2A Southampton Way, London, United Kingdom (Open map)
Hyde Park Square 2, London W2 2Aa, United Kingdom, London, United Kingdom (Open map)
118, Purley, United Kingdom (Open map)
43 Thatches Grove, Romford, United Kingdom (Open map)
White Conduit Street, London, United Kingdom (Open map)
5 Radcliffe Road Romana Court, South Norwood, United Kingdom (Open map)
9 Fitzroy Mews, London, United Kingdom (Open map)
21 Seymour Street, London, United Kingdom (Open map)
183A Northolt Road, Harrow on the Hill, United Kingdom (Open map)
27 Brigstock Road, Thornton Heath, United Kingdom (Open map)
Liverpool Road, London, United Kingdom (Open map)
5 Kingswater Place, London, United Kingdom (Open map)